ABOUT THIS BOOK

"How to Play Mandolin for Beginners" is an essential manual that functions as an exhaustive resource for inexperienced musicians, furnishing a thorough groundwork for attaining proficiency in the complexities inherent in this distinctive musical instrument. This book begins with an extensive Introduction to the Mandolin, which establishes the foundation for a methodical exploration of the instrument. The chapter titled "Anatomy of the Mandolin" offers a comprehensive examination of the structure of the instrument, thereby fostering a more profound rapport between the musician and their mandolin.

A critical segment, Choosing the Right Mandolin assists novices in making well-informed choices regarding the acquisition of an instrument. The chapters titled "Tuning Your Mandolin" and "Basic Mandolin Techniques" prioritize fundamental elements, guaranteeing a strong understanding of critical abilities. By incorporating subjects like Mandolin Holding and Playing Your First Notes, a pragmatic methodology is established, which aids novices in navigating their initial obstacles.

This book advances to the realm of music theory, providing valuable perspectives on Fundamental Chords for Mandolin, Understanding Sheet Music and Tabs, and Simple Melodies for Novices. The development of dexterity involves finger exercises and picking techniques, whereas the inclusion of an introduction to strumming and playing simple songs enhances the player's repertoire with an additional dimension of versatility.

Prospective mandolinists will find the comprehensive material on Common Mandolin Scales, Repertoire Development, and Style Exploration to be highly valuable.

This resource accommodates a wide range of musical tastes, including Bluegrass, Folk, and Classical. Suggestions for Overcoming Frequent Obstacles in the Learning Process are addressed in Tips for Effective Practice and Troubleshooting Common Challenges, whereas practical guidance on Mandolin Maintenance and Care guarantees the instrument's longevity.

In addition to chapters dedicated to individual practice, this book encompasses topics such as Playing with Others: Jamming and Group Settings, Recording Your Mandolin Playing, Setting Goals, and Tracking Progress. Every chapter in "How to Play Mandolin for Beginners" has been carefully constructed to assist novices in their musical exploration, rendering it an indispensable resource for anyone embarking on the mesmerizing realm of mandolin playing.
